Jim Hamilton of Hamilton’s Garage on the corner of the Arkell Road and the Brock Road (now Gordon St. S.), lived there all of his life. It was part of Puslinch Township until c.1966, when it was annexed to Guelph. His family actually settled on that lot in the 1830’s and it has been in the family ever since.
